Position Summary

Reporting to the Senior Manager, Data Marketing & Creative Services, the Manager, Digital Marketing leverages data-driven insights and audience-centric strategies to execute and optimize Tourism Whistler’s paid marketing and email initiatives. This role is responsible for managing and enhancing performance across digital advertising platforms—including paid search, social, and display—while supporting comprehensive analytics, campaign tracking, and reporting. The Manager will play a key role in driving measurable marketing outcomes through thoughtful data application, collaboration, and continuous optimization.

Key Responsibilities

  • Act as a Tourism Whistler ambassador, living our purpose and vision with passion & energy, achievement and respect
  • Execute Google Ads initiatives to ensure paid search campaigns support overall sales goals
  • Collaborate with agency and internal teams to plan and optimize paid social campaigns
  • Track and report on campaign performance using GA4 and related analytics tools
  • Manage and implement pixel tracking to ensure accurate and compliant data collection
  • Leverage first-party data to drive marketing performance and identify growth opportunities
  • Collaborate with partners to utilize second-party data for enhanced audience targeting
  • Oversee dynamic creative platforms to deliver personalized, timely messaging
  • Lead email marketing initiatives to ensure effective, consistent customer communication
  • Develop and oversee promotions and data capture strategies in collaboration with the Specialist, Data Marketing & Promotions
  • Manage and mentor direct reports; Specialist, Email Marketing, and Specialist, Data Marketing & Promotions
  • Support budget management and forecasting for promotions, paid search, and paid social programs
  • Provide cross-functional support within the Data Marketing & Creative Services team

Knowledge, Skills & Abilities

  • Passion and knowledge of Whistler, mountain resorts, and the tourism industry
  • Post-secondary education in marketing, analytics or a related discipline
  • Minimum of three years’ experience in marketing, promotions, or a comparable role
  • Proficient in Google Ads and GA4, with familiarity across the Google Marketing Platform
  • Advanced skills in Excel, Google Sheets, and ad-hoc data analysis
  • Working knowledge of HTML and dynamic creative tools considered an asset
  • Strong understanding of CASL and data privacy legislation to ensure compliance
  • Analytical and innovative thinker with exceptional attention to detail
  • Proven ability to perform effectively in a fast-paced and evolving environment
  • Demonstrated passion for data-driven marketing and analytics
